George School, an all-gender Quaker boarding/day high school located in Newtown, PA, seeks a Director of Auxiliary Programs.
Responsibilities
Oversee the daily operations of the school store, summer academy, summer day camp, children’s center, aquatics and other auxiliary programs.
Leverage the school’s intellectual, cultural, and physical assets to expand program offerings.
Establish and nurture a team culture rooted in excellence, equity, collaboration, and mission alignment across all auxiliary and summer programs.
Oversee the recruitment, hiring, onboarding and supervision of staff for all summer and auxiliary programs.
Ensure accessibility, equity, and inclusion are integrated into all aspects of program development.
Assess and enhance current programs and develop new programs through market research.
Oversee the financial performance of all auxiliary initiatives, ensuring revenue targets are met or exceeded.
Direct financial administration for auxiliary programs, including invoicing, billing, deposits, journal entries, revenue recognition, and internal transfers.
Oversee and maintain enrollment, billing, and staffing.
Ensure that auxiliary programs enhance and reflect the school’s brand and reputation.
Oversee registration platforms and enrollment processes, ensuring accuracy, functionality, and a positive family experience.
Coordinate program communications related to enrollment, billing, attendance, and program logistics.
Collaborate closely with George School Finance, HR, Marketing & Communications, Facilities, and program leadership to ensure effective program delivery.

Requirements
Bachelor’s degree in Education, Business Administration, or related field.
Minimum 3 years of experience in auxiliary program management, preferably in an educational setting.
Proven track record of program development, financial management, and team leadership.
Excellent communication, interpersonal, and problem-solving skills.
